Penguins' star Crosby could return against Panthers (Yahoo Sports)

Pittsburgh Penguins' Sidney Crosby talks with reporters at his locker after skating at the Penguins' practice facility in Cranberry Township, Pa., Tuesday, Oct. 11, 2016. Crosby was diagnosed with a concussion by team doctors Monday. (AP Photo/Gene J. Puskar)

Pittsburgh Penguins star Sidney Crosby could make his season debut Tuesday night against Florida. Crosby returned to practice on Monday and participated in Pittsburgh's game-day skate on Tuesday morning. Coach Mike Sullivan said it's ''likely'' that Crosby will play.
